Celebrating Philippine Independence Day: Honoring Freedom, Heritage, and Community

Every June, Filipinos around the world come together to celebrate one of the most significant moments in Philippine history—Philippine Independence Day. Observed annually on June 12, this special occasion commemorates the declaration of Philippine independence from Spanish rule in 1898 and serves as a powerful reminder of the courage, resilience, and unity of the Filipino people.

A Day That Shaped a Nation

On June 12, 1898, Filipino revolutionary leader Emilio Aguinaldo proclaimed the independence of the Philippines in Kawit, Cavite. After centuries of colonial rule, Filipinos demonstrated remarkable courage and determination in their pursuit of freedom and self-governance.

Today, Independence Day is more than a historical commemoration. It is a celebration of the Filipino spirit—a spirit characterized by perseverance, optimism, and an unwavering commitment to family and community.

The Strength of the Filipino Community

The Filipino community has become one of the fastest-growing and most vibrant communities in British Columbia. Across Surrey and the Lower Mainland, Filipinos contribute significantly to healthcare, education, business, public service, construction, hospitality, and countless other industries.

Independence Day provides an opportunity to celebrate not only our history but also the many accomplishments of Filipino Canadians who continue to make a positive impact in their communities.
